Direct admission to B.Tech at RVITM, Bangalore, is not available for most students. The primary mode of admission is through entrance exams and merit-based selection. Here's an overview of the admission process:
Eligibility:
- Passed 10+2 (or equivalent) examination with a minimum of 45% aggregate marks in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ics.
- Secured a valid score in KCET (Karnataka Common Entrance Test) or COMEDK UGET (Consortium of Medical, Engineering and Dental Colleges Under Graduate Entrance Test).

Yes, the RV Institute of Technology and Management may reserve seats under different categories in its BE programmes. However, for admission in these reserved seats, the relevant documents have to be submitted. On verification, the seat allotment is done. Aspirants can check below the category-wise seat reservation information:
- KCET (Karnataka Candidates): 45%
- COMEDK (Pan India): 30%
- Management Quota: 25%
There are a total of 390 seats for BE courses offered at RVITM Bangalore. Out of total intake, the highest seat count is for the Computer Science and Engineering branch - 180 seats. The institute allot seats through KEA counselling. During allotment process, the sanctioned seat count is also considered. Moreover, the students must note that the seat details given here are as per the official website/ sanctioning body. This information is subject to changes and hence, is indicative.
RV Institute of Technology and Management admit candidates based on performance in KCET/ COMEDK. The cutoff list is released following the exam result. Candidates who meet the RVITM BE cutoff become eligible for seat allotment. In 2024, the second round closing rank for the general All-India category candidates was 10066 for CSE, 13924 for Information Science and Engineering, and 15188 for ECE. Considering the last three years' cutoff data, a declining trend is observed.
The students seeking admission in a BE course of RV Institute of Technology and Management have to submit the important documents. Candidates shall keep the scanned copies handy. These documents are required by the institute to verify the provided information in the application form. Mentioned below are some of the important documents:
- Original admission order issued by KEA
- Class 10 and Class 12 original marksheet
- Transfer Certificate
- Student who have studied outside Karnataka need to submit Migration Certificate
- Photocopy of student Aadhaar Card, etc.
